Pet Vaccinations for Dogs
A basic dog vaccination, such as is a C5 vaccination, at your regional veterinarian clinic in Brooke UK will supply security against parvovirus, distemper, hepatitis, bordetella and parainfluenza (kennel cough). Generally, the kennel cough element will only last 12 months therefore yearly boosters will be needed. The regional veterinarians at Chapelfield Veterinary Partnership can encourage you on whether or not additional vaccinations for your pet dog, such as leptospirosis vaccination is needed for your pet. This vaccination for canines is normally available at an extra cost.

Pet Vaccinations for Cats
The basic vaccination for felines such as, an F3 vaccination by your local veterinarians in Brooke UK will supply security versus panleukopenia virus (feline enteritis), herpesvirus (cat influenza), and calicivirus (cat influenza). Depending upon your feline’s danger profile and feline vaccination schedule, your regional vets at Chapelfield Veterinary Partnership may also suggest vaccination versus Feline Aids (FIV vaccination). This feline vaccination is readily available at an additional expense.

Pet Vaccinations for Rabbits
A minimum of, once a year, rabbits require vaccination for calicivirus. There are times, your regional vets at Chapelfield Veterinary Partnership may suggest a shorter period between vaccinations depending upon the regional threat to your rabbit connecting to the regional authority’s calicivirus releases.
